Maw Broon’s Kitchen to open in Dundee

DC Thomson bringing brand to life with new city centre outlet from 2017.

Following the successful retail launch of a range of Maw Broon’s Kitchen-branded food products, DC Thomson will open a real-life kitchen in Dundee city centre in 2017.

The venue will aim to capture the essence of The Broons family, who are celebrating the 80th anniversary of their first appearance in the Sunday Post in 1936.

The kitchen will merge ‘old fashioned notions of hospitality and comfort with good honest food and excellent customer service’.

It will offer Scottish staples from mince n tatties to ‘efternoon tea’, as well as lighter bites and Daphne’s deli.

Marketing and business development specialist, Victoria Tait has been working with DC Thomson to bring the concept to life.

The concept was initially tested with a pop-up at The Eat, Drink, Discover Food Festival back in September 2014, receiving an overwhelmingly positive reaction.

Victoria commented: “People just loved it. It created a real sense of nostalgia because everyone was talking about their memories of The Broons. I’m sure those feelings of warmth will carry through.”

Martin Lindsay, licensing manager for consumer products at DC Thomson, added: “The launch of a Maw Broon’s Kitchen in Dundee, the spiritual home of The Broons, is a very exciting development for the Maw Broon’s Kitchen licensing programme.”

As well as the food offering, the Dundee venue will also host regular events and activities such as storytelling and live Scottish entertainment.
